返回列表 发帖

[经验交流] 【绿色插件】“快速启动”扩展的使用【便携修改】

本帖最后由 wtv.ur 于 2009-10-25 10:09 编辑

原先tw的1.0和2.0版本,都是可以自制插件,然后把插件跟主程序跟ini文件打包压缩随身带着走的。到了3.0,插件一直以来都只有那几样……
不过随着3.0.7.4(虽然有bug)附带的“快速启动”扩展(这个才是主角)出来以后,这个现象应该可以改观。自制插件有很大一部分是exe,可以添加到快速启动的快捷方式里,虽然还是不能便携。至于要便携化,可以通过以下方法解决:

把要添加的程序放在TheWorld 3下面的任意目录下,添加,打开Extensions\ExtQuickLaunch下的ExtQuickLaunch.ini(添加过一次程序之后才会出现),里面[main]项下面是已经添加过的程序。比如把procexp.exe放在TheWorld 3\Extensions\procexp\下,添加完以后:

[main]
……
……
pathX=D:\浏览\TheWorld 3\Extensions\procexp\procexp.exe
nameX=procexp.exe
iconX=D:\浏览\TheWorld 3\Extensions\procexp\procexp.exe

path是程序的绝对路径,name是名称,icon是显示图标的绝对路径。X是数字,似乎是用来区分不同程序的,不重复就行,不必太在意。那么只要把path和icon的路径改成相对tw3主程序的路径(名称想改也可以改):

pathX=.\Extensions\procexp\procexp.exe
nameX=任务管理器
iconX=.\Extensions\procexp\procexp.exe

就可以和1.0,2.0一样打包TheWorld 3文件夹随处携带了。细节上大家可以随意发挥……

这大概可以看做开发组对tw3.0自制插件的一种开放。不过还是有一点问题。首先“快速启动”扩展本身还有一些问题,另外网页工具类的插件无法通过这种方法添加。最大的问题是,对这种改动的支持似乎有问题。便携改动完成以后,用tw再添加任意程序的快速启动快捷方式,之前改动成便携的快速启动快捷方式就会出错,再重启一遍tw3才会恢复正常。貌似是快速启动的快捷方式的起始位置是随着每次添加改变的,所以相对路径会出错。希望能固定到tw3主程序路径。

恩恩,总之希望能完善吧……

非常感谢,当然都是喜欢放TW3目录下的了

path2=.\插件\minipad2\minipad2.exe
name2=记事本
icon2=.\插件\minipad2\minipad2.exe


我也改好了,哈

开发组跟进啊,添加插件的时候复制一份到TW3目录下,从那里直接启动不就行了么

====================

顺便问下2.0   DLL形式或是HTM类的插件怎么添加??
http://bbs.ioage.com/cn/thread-108931-1-1.html
TW3.0皮肤--炎夏之夜  菜单的质感

TOP

本帖最后由 wtv.ur 于 2009-10-24 16:35 编辑
非常感谢,当然都是喜欢放TW3目录下的了



我也改好了,哈

开发组跟进啊,添加插件的时候复制一份到TW3目录下,从那里直接启动不就行了么

====================

顺便问下2.0   DLL形式或是HTM类的插件怎么 ...
勿谈国事 发表于 2009-10-24 15:35 http://bbs.ioage.com/cn/images/common/back.gif


嗯嗯……我没电脑,现在U盘里就是tw1,tw2,tw3,plugin文件夹各一个打包,改好tw3以后要用哪个就解压把plugin文件夹扔到哪个目录下(以前用3.0还要准备着2.0备用插件)……

HTM类应该是SCRIPT,DLL类我见的不多,应该是COM……直接添加貌似是不行的……我也不知道怎么办……

TOP

对网页类的插件不支持啊,比如超级转帖工具。

TOP

对网页类的插件不支持啊,比如超级转帖工具。
hhzxedu 发表于 2009-10-25 09:17 http://bbs.ioage.com/cn/images/common/back.gif

的确网页类添加不能……我等下试试看dll类能不能像3.0的扩展一样添加……不过估计是不可能吧……

TOP

开发组人太少啊
◥ 昨天有幾個女生說我長的帥..z×
×︵丣 倵ǒ笑了笑 沒有承認 ┈Õ 她們居然

TOP

这个不错,但必竟不是正道。只有TW3.0支持这些插件才好。
无欲则刚

TOP

返回列表